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
* perimetric examination using static stimuli, assessing the entire (80 degree) visual field with a fast thresholding algorithm (GATE) \[Schiefer 2008\] to know the extent/ magnitude of the visual field defect and its variability within the cohort and over time
* D-BCVA, using FrACT \[Bach 2007\] and EDTRS chart \[Ferris 1982\]
* RAPD (using swinging flashlight test).
* IOP (using applanation tonometer)
* RNFT and RNFV using Spectralis OCT (star scan, ring scan 2,8 mm, and volume scan) Optic disk morphology will be documented by fundus photography. This assessment of the above-mentioned data is needed in order to allow for estimation of the spontaneous course / fluctuation of the (quantified) functional and morphometric parameters of the N-AION patients during the follow-up period. This is essential for the estimation of the sample size of the subsequently intended SINN study, that is intended to compare different therapeutic strategies in N-AION patients.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* 41 - 80 years, informed consent
* acute N-AION (\< 7 d)
* D-BCVA \> 0.1 (2/20)
* RAPD ≥ 0.3 logE steps (neutral density filters) and:
* spherical ametropia max. ± 8 dpt, cylindrical ametropia max. ± 3 dpt
* isocoria, pupil diameter \> 3 mm
Exclusion Criteria
* history of epilepsy or significant psychiatric disease
* medications known to affect visual field sensitivity
* infections (e.g. keratitis, conjunctivitis, uveitis)
* severe dry eyes
* miotic drug
* amblyopia
* strabismus
* any ocular pathology, in either eye, that may interfere with the ability to obtain visual fields, disc imaging or accurate IOP readings
* cataract with relevant impairment of vision
* keratoconus
* intraocular surgery (except for uncomplicated cataract surgery) performed \< 3 month prior to screening
* history or signs of any visual pathway affection other than N-AION
* history or presence of macular disease and / or macular edema
* ocular trauma
